EGN 311  -  Coastal Engineering and Fluids Lab


Applied methods in laboratory investigations into coastal engineering and fluid mechanics principles in a sequence of seven experiments: hydrostatic pressure on submerged surface, stability of a floating body, flow from a hole, hydraulic jump, flow measurement, wave measurements in a wave flume, and beach sediment analysis. 

Credit Hours: 1

Prerequisite Courses: EGN 330 (C- or better)
Course Repeatability: Course may not be repeated.
